Filter Results

Mushrooms Subcategories

Mushrooms Brands

Price

Mushrooms

OM Mushroom Superfood

Superfood Mushroom Blend

3 Options from ¥405 - ¥3852

Save up to 88%

See Options

Now

Lion's Mane 60 vcaps

Our price ¥2068

Save 47%

Add to Cart